3.5.1. Firmware and security

The Firmware architecture ensures protection of legally relevant metrological functionality
within the micro controller from manipulation. It also allows flexibility to the non-
metrologically relevant functionalities and communication options that are essential for the
smart metering application.
The protection is based on multicore micro controller. The firmware architecture offers a
secure and robust design for the software interaction by isolating the sensitive and legally
compliant files from the rest.
As the meter deals with legally relevant information and other operational parts, it is designed
to fulfill the highest security standards for the metering components.
LNR part consist of application and communication components and peripherals. Separated
with a protected interface, the legally non relevant part of the Firmware is used for BLE
communication, Application etc.
LR the legally relevant section of the firmware is separated using protected interface to keep
it isolated from the legally non relevant part. This part of the firmware consists of components
for buttons and display screen. Some other sensitive components are the metrology chip and
security chip.
The E-Mon® Energy Meter operates within a network and the security setup shall be
performed to restrict unauthorized access. Kindly go through installation and security best
practice guidelines and safeguard your network from outside interference or external attack.
